SOUTHERN INDIANA, CLARK-FLOYD COUNTIES CONVENTION-TOURISM BUREAU

2011 Highlights

Committed $1.17 million to five bonds for capital development projects; the projects are City of Jeffersonville riverfront; Town of Clarksville museum; Falls of the Ohio Interpretive Center; New Albany Fire Museum and Carnegie Center for Art & History

Produced a magazine style Southern Indiana Visitor Guide in cooperation with the News and Tribune staff; Visitor Guide featured local attractions, events and lodging plus paid advertisements; Distributed 10,000 guides to local attractions, restaurants, lodging facilities, visitor centers and state welcome centers

Continued to produce the monthly "Sunny Side Times" newspaper to promote visitor spending in Clark-Floyd Counties

Conducted a major advertising campaign in Indianapolis for the fall which included newspaper, television, radio and website

Advertised regularly in Evansville Living, Indianapolis Monthly and AAA Hoosier magazines

Participated in cooperative advertising with the Southern Indiana Regional Marketing Cooperative in the national History Channel Magazine; Feature was the Lewis and Clark Expedition, received nearly 800 requests for information and sent follow-up information

Had regular ads in regional tourism publications such as Louisville CVB Visitor Guide, Welcome to Greater Louisville, Louisville Explorer Map and the new KFC Arena Guide

Worked with the planner of the first-ever Southern Indiana Tri-Athlon to host the event in Jeffersonville on June 5; The event had 120 participants who swam one mile in the Ohio River, biked for 26 miles and ran 6 miles; The Ohio River was major attractant for the participants and all of the events had a connection to the river

Utilized the internet and email services to promote Sunny Side of Louisville attractions, events and lodging facilities; Updated website to give it a fresher look and switched to an easier host server; Send a weekly e-newsletter ("Friday Blast") to subscribers to encourage attendance at weekend events; More than 1,000 subscribers receive the "Friday Blast"

Staffed and operated the Southern Indiana Visitor Center at I-65, Exit 0 in Jeffersonville; Staffed the I-65 southbound rest area near Henryville

Serviced numerous conventions by providing nametags, itinerary planning assistance and concierge desks; Events were mainly held at Holiday Inn Lakeview and Sheraton Riverside

Worked with professional destination consultant to form a five year strategic destination plan; Received input from industry partners and board members

Promoted Clarksville as the host site for the 2012 annual meeting of the Lewis and Clark National Foundation

Advertised Sunny Side of Louisville in group tour publications such as Group Tour Magazine and Bank Travel Magazine; Worked with Group Tour Magazine staff to offer cooperative ad rates to local hospitality partners

Supported the first Southern Indiana African American Heritage Conference held in Jeffersonville to promote the developing African American Heritage Trail; University scholars from Harvard University, University of Louisville and Indiana University Purdue University of Indianapolis were among the conference speakers along with Indiana's first African American Federal Judge, Tonya Walton Pratt

Conducted regular meetings with the hospitality industry (attractions, lodging, restaurants, retail, events, etc.) to keep them informed of Bureau activities, seek input for marketing, gauge business trends and develop partnerships

Hosted the annual Sunny Side Tourism Luncheon as part of National Tourism Week to recognize individuals who have influenced visitor spending in Clark-Floyd Counties; Charlie Jenkins received the John H. Minta Tourism Award for his efforts to create the Sunny Side of Louisville slogan

Continued promotion and support for the Ohio River Scenic Byway, a designated national scenic route; Produced a brochure to promote the Ohio River Scenic Byway in Clark-Floyd Counties that features the 17 intepretive panels installed here; Assisted with hosting the Tri-State (Indiana, Kentucky and Ohio) Conference of the Ohio River Scenic Byway at the Howard Steamboat Museum and Holiday Inn Lakeview; Jim Keith serves on the ORSB board

Supported the Ohio River Greenway Commission; Jim Keith serves on the board and they host regular meetings at the Bureau office
